Which term is used interchangeably with Military Mail Terminal?

The term that is used interchangeably with Military Mail Terminal is the Aerial Mail Terminal (AMT). This is because both terms refer to facilities designated for the processing and handling of mail intended for military personnel, particularly in relation to air transport. Aerial Mail Terminals specifically focus on mail that is transported by air, which is a critical service for military communication and logistics, especially in theater operations where ground access may be limited or non-existent.

The other options, while related to mail services, refer to different types of mail operations. The Official Mail Center (OMC) primarily deals with government-related mail but is not restricted to military contexts. The Military Post Office (MPO) refers specifically to postal facilities located on military installations but does not encompass the broader function of processing aerial mail. The Activity Distribution Office (ADO) is involved in the management of mail within specific activities or units, rather than serving as a direct equivalent to a Military Mail Terminal. Thus, Aerial Mail Terminal is the most fitting term that aligns with and describes the role of a Military Mail Terminal.
